Internal Structure
Sensor: Built-in sensors measure the controlled process variables in real time.
Microprocessor: Receives sensor measurements and compares them with user-set target values.
Actuator: Drives the valve core to change the valve opening according to instructions from the microprocessor.
Digital Communication Interface: Typically supports fieldbus protocols for high-speed, bidirectional digital communication with the higher-level control system.
A Digital Regulator is a type of control valve—an intelligent, fully integrated control system that combines measurement, control, and execution into a single unit.
Digital regulator valve represents a significant trend in the field of industrial automation, marking the shift from analog to digital and from decentralized control to distributed intelligent control.
When people refer to a "Digital Regulator," they are generally referring to this highly integrated digital control valve solution.
